
Loudoun United FC have acquired defender Peabo Doue for their inaugural season in the USL Championship pending league and federation approval.
“Peabo has an ample amount of experience in the USL already,” Richie Williams, Loudoun United FC Head Coach, said. “We are excited to add another local player to the roster and can’t wait to see what he accomplishes on the field.”
Doue joins Loudoun United FC after spending one season (2017-2018) with North Carolina FC, a USL Championship team. In his time with North Carolina he made 19 appearances totaling in 1,004 minutes. Doue scored one goal and recorded one assist that season.
Starting his career in 2013 with Phoenix FC in their inaugural season, he scored once in 17 appearances. Doue has appeared in 79 USL Championship matches, totaling over 4,000 minutes, scoring three times and assisting two goals in his time in the league. Doue also made six Lamar Hunt US Open Cup appearances, totaling 521 minutes.
Doue is from Takoma Park, Md., and played in the D.C. United Academy. He was a 2008 MLS U-17 Cup finalist with the Academy. He went on to play at West Virginia University (2009-2012). In his four years with West Virginia, Doue made 75 appearances; scoring 10 goals and recording 12 assists.
Player: Peabo Doue
Position: Defender
Birthplace: Takoma Park, Md.
Country: USA
Birthdate: 12/28/91
Age: 27
Height: 5-10
Weight: 175 lbs
Status: Domestic
School: West Virginia University
